Sadnha was telling me about a project she saw that was at the Tate a while ago, in which a design company took over the education/outreach programme at the Tate for a day, in which they set a brief to young school children. It basically involved the kids into thinking about the art they saw and what they thinks constitutes something being called a piece of art. The design company said to the children, you need to make a set of rules for piece of art, and then they had to walk around the gallery and decide what 'art' they thought broke the rules that they had made, and why it had. This in turn made the kids think about the art, and what makes it art, making them take in their surroundings and build up an integral part of their learning.
